オンラインスクールを受講して1か月くらいから作り始めた初めてのオリジナル3Dゲームです。
簡単な操作で手軽に遊べるゲームを目標に作成しました。
このゲームの作成で注力した点は
①アイテムと障害物をランダム生成にした点
②スコアを計算してハイスコアが出た場合に自動的にハイスコアを上書き保存できるようにした点
③ゲームを1度完成させた後、3Dキャラをもう1体追加してベースは同じものの操作感の違うゲームモードを実装した点です。
特に苦労したところは、アイテムと障害物をランダム生成にしたせいですべてのレーンに障害物が生成されるパターンを解消するために、生成したオブジェクトを管理してすべてが障害物だった場合にどれか一つをアイテムに置き換える機能を実装したところです。
UnityRoomに公開したゲームページのURL↓
RUN RUN RUN - https://unityroom.com/games/run_run_run